Ingredients:
Ingredients | Quantity |
---|---|
Onion | 1/2 |
Zucchini | 1 |
Eggplants | 1 |
Chopped tomatoes | 1 |
Garlic | 3 cloves |
Salt | 3 pinches |
Oregano | 3 pinches |
Orange juice | 1/2 cup |
Olive oil | 1 tablespoon |
Basil leaves (optional) | For garnish |
Instructions:
-
Prepare Ingredients:
- Gather all the ingredients: onion, zucchini, eggplants, chopped tomatoes, garlic, salt, oregano, orange juice, and olive oil.
- Chop the onion, zucchini, and eggplants into bite-sized pieces. Mince the garlic cloves.
-
Cooking:
- In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ium-high heat until shimmering.
- Add the chopped onion to the skillet and sauté until translucent and fragrant.
- Next, add the diced zucchini and eggplants to the skillet, stirring occasionally, and cook until they start to soften, approximately 5 minutes.
-
Simmering:
- Pour in the orange juice and bring it to a gentle boil.
- Stir in the chopped tomatoes, minced garlic, salt, and oregano, ensuring all the vegetables are well coated in the flavorsome mixture.
- Cover the skillet with a lid and reduce the heat to low. Allow the ratatouille to simmer gently for about 10 minutes, or until the vegetables are tender and the flavors have melded beautifully.
-
Serve:
- Once the ratatouille is ready, remove the skillet from the heat.
- Garnish with fresh basil leaves, if desired, for an extra burst of flavor and freshness.
- Serve the ratatouille hot, either as a standalone dish or as a delightful accompaniment to crusty bread, rice, or pasta.
